Lecture notes shared by students are collaboratively created, circulated, and accessed documents that summarize, explain, or expand upon course material. These notes are typically exchanged through online platforms, forums, or shared drives, facilitating peer-to-peer learning and supplementing official instructional resources.

Key Features

  • Collaborative content creation among students
  • Accessible via online platforms and file-sharing services
  • Supplement to official lecture materials
  • Potential for real-time updates and peer review
  • Variety in quality and depth depending on contributors

Pros

  • Enhances understanding through multiple perspectives
  • Accessible resources at any time for review and study
  • Encourages collaborative learning and community building
  • Cost-effective alternative to paid study aids

Cons

  • Variable quality and accuracy of notes
  • Potential spread of misinformation or errors
  • Copyright concerns with sharing certain materials
  • Dependence on student contributors' diligence and expertise
